Alcohol Addiction in Central, South Carolina
Of the 11,879 individuals currently living in Central, South Carolina, 5,346 don't drink alcohol and 3,089 say that they consume alcohol less than once a week. In Central, South Carolina 8,434 individuals don't drink an unhealthy amount of alcohol. There are, however, 2,851 people in Central, South Carolina that consume an amount of alcohol that would classify them as heavy drinkers.

According to research on alcohol advertising, there is not a strong connection between ads for alcohol and alcohol consumption and abuse in Central, South Carolina. That does not hold true for their effects on children. Research indicates that children that are exposed to alcohol-related advertisements in Central, South Carolina are more prone to start drinking at a younger age and to look upon drinking alcohol as a positive thing. This also translates to a higher number of children in Central, South Carolina who grow up to be alcohol drinkers.
